Our shop includes the Art Space – designed especially for workshops and exhibitions to celebrate and support the local community. For enquiries about using the Art Space please contact glasgowartspace@cassart.co.uk
We are thrilled to have opened an art store on queens street in a city with such a rich cultural heritage and strong artist community. We look forward to supporting artists of all ages with the world’s leading art and craft brands at the most affordable prices.
You can find a huge choice of materials in store including canvas by the metre.
Cass Art is the UK’s leading art materials supplier. We provide the world’s best art brands at the most affordable prices, and our staff are all artists so that we can provide friendly, expert advice on all your creative projects at our art supplies store.
